summaryrefslogtreecommitdiff
path: root/chat
diff options
context:
space:
mode:
authorkhorben <khorben>2017-03-11 03:02:39 +0000
committerkhorben <khorben>2017-03-11 03:02:39 +0000
commitaf43f3772ed38ad5a637ce20f88c7c7c8c3a2ab6 (patch)
tree25b19cd7c1db51f87371e217978a3f021d41dcb1 /chat
parentb459556d62604babf5e394b674f18997ee48f7c8 (diff)
downloadpkgsrc-af43f3772ed38ad5a637ce20f88c7c7c8c3a2ab6.tar.gz
Update chat/{libpurple,pidgin} to version 2.11.0
version 2.11.0 (06/21/2016): General: * 2.10.12 was accidentally released with new additions to the API and should have been released as 2.11.0. Unfortunately, we did not catch the mistake until after 2.10.12 was released, but we're fixing it now. See ChangeLog.API for more information. * Include the Mozilla certificate bundle. This fixes connecting to servers with certificates from Let's Encrypt. * Remove all 1024-bit CAs libpurple: * media: fix an issue with ximagesink displaying only a corner cut-out of a larger webcam video (Jakub Adam) * mediamanager: update output window destruction so that it reflects recent changes in the media pipeline structure (Jakub Adam) * Ported Instantbird's CommandUiOps to libpurple (Dequis) Pidgin: * Fixed #14962 * Fixed alignment of incoming right-to-left messages in protocols that don't support rich text * Fix a potential crash while exiting pidgin Windows-Specific Changes: * Use getaddrinfo for DNS to enable IPv6 (#1075) * Updates to dependencies: * NSS 3.24 and NSPR 4.12. AIM: * Add support for the newer kerberos-based authentication of AIM 8.x Bonjour * Fixed building on Mac OSX (Patrick Cloke) (#16883) ICQ: * Stop truncating passwords to 8 characters like old ICQ clients did. (#16692). If you actually needed this, truncate your password manually by pressing backspace a few times. IRC: * Base64-decode SASL messages before passing to libsasl (#16268) MXit * Fixed a buffer overflow.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0120) * Fixed a remote out-of-bounds read.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0140) * Fixed a remote out-of-band read.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0138, TALOS-CAN-0135) * Fixed an invalid read. Discovered by Yves Younan of Cisco Talos (TALOS-CAN-0118) * Fixed a remote buffer overflow vulnerability.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0119) * Fixed an out-of-bounds read disc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0123) * Fixed a directory traversal issue. Discovered by Yves Younan of Cisco Talos (TALOS-CAN-0128) * Fixed a remote denial of service vulnerability that could result in a null pointer dereference.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0133) * Fixed a remote denial of service that could result in an out-of-bounds read. Discovered by Yves Younan of Cisco Talos (TALOS-CAN-0134) * Fixed multiple remote buffer overflows.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0136) * Fixed a remote NULL pointer dereference. Discovered by Yves Younan of Cisco Talos (TALOS-CAN-0137) * Fixed a remote code execution issue disc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0142) * Fixed a remote denial of service vulnerability in contact mood handling. Discovered by Yves Younan of Cisco Talos (TALOS-CAN-0141) * Fixed a remote out-of-bounds write vulnerability.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0139) * Fix a remote out-of-bounds read. Discovered by Yves Younan of Cisco Talos. (TALOS-CAN-0143)
Diffstat (limited to 'chat')
-rw-r--r--chat/libpurple/Makefile.common4
-rw-r--r--chat/libpurple/PLIST30
-rw-r--r--chat/libpurple/buildlink3.mk6
-rw-r--r--chat/libpurple/distinfo10
-rw-r--r--chat/pidgin/PLIST3
5 files changed, 14 insertions, 39 deletions
diff --git a/chat/libpurple/Makefile.common b/chat/libpurple/Makefile.common
index d8caa4e0cf8..8b4e2c59641 100644
--- a/chat/libpurple/Makefile.common
+++ b/chat/libpurple/Makefile.common
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ile.common,v 1.46 2016/01/13 22:25:38 wiz Exp $
+# $NetBSD: Makefile.common,v 1.47 2017/03/11 03:02:39 khorben Exp $
#
# used by chat/finch/Makefile
# used by chat/libpurple/Makefile
@@ -6,7 +6,7 @@
# used by chat/pidgin-sametime/Makefile
# used by chat/pidgin-silc/Makefile
-PIDGIN_VERSION= 2.10.12
+PIDGIN_VERSION= 2.11.0
DISTNAME= pidgin-${PIDGIN_VERSION}
CATEGORIES= chat
MASTER_SITES= ${MASTER_SITE_SOURCEFORGE:=pidgin/}
diff --git a/chat/libpurple/PLIST b/chat/libpurple/PLIST
index cbbcf7db4ea..4b30317b52f 100644
--- a/chat/libpurple/PLIST
+++ b/chat/libpurple/PLIST
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.31 2016/01/13 22:25:38 wiz Exp $
+@comment $NetBSD: PLIST,v 1.32 2017/03/11 03:02:39 khorben Exp $
include/libpurple/account.h
include/libpurple/accountopt.h
include/libpurple/blist.h
@@ -193,35 +193,9 @@ share/locale/xh/LC_MESSAGES/pidgin.mo
share/locale/zh_CN/LC_MESSAGES/pidgin.mo
share/locale/zh_HK/LC_MESSAGES/pidgin.mo
share/locale/zh_TW/LC_MESSAGES/pidgin.mo
-share/purple/ca-certs/AOL_Member_CA.pem
-share/purple/ca-certs/AddTrust_External_Root.pem
-share/purple/ca-certs/America_Online_Root_Certification_Authority_1.pem
-share/purple/ca-certs/Baltimore_CyberTrust_Root.pem
share/purple/ca-certs/CAcert_Class3.pem
share/purple/ca-certs/CAcert_Root.pem
-share/purple/ca-certs/Certum_Root_CA.pem
-share/purple/ca-certs/Certum_Trusted_Network_CA.pem
-share/purple/ca-certs/Deutsche_Telekom_Root_CA_2.pem
-share/purple/ca-certs/DigiCertHighAssuranceCA-3.pem
-share/purple/ca-certs/DigiCertHighAssuranceEVRootCA.pem
-share/purple/ca-certs/Entrust.net_2048.pem
-share/purple/ca-certs/Entrust.net_Secure_Server_CA.pem
-share/purple/ca-certs/Equifax_Secure_CA.pem
-share/purple/ca-certs/Equifax_Secure_Global_eBusiness_CA-1.pem
-share/purple/ca-certs/GTE_CyberTrust_Global_Root.pem
-share/purple/ca-certs/Go_Daddy_Class_2_CA.pem
-share/purple/ca-certs/Microsoft_Internet_Authority_2010.pem
-share/purple/ca-certs/Microsoft_Secure_Server_Authority_2010.pem
-share/purple/ca-certs/StartCom_Certification_Authority.pem
-share/purple/ca-certs/Thawte_Premium_Server_CA.pem
-share/purple/ca-certs/Thawte_Primary_Root_CA.pem
-share/purple/ca-certs/ValiCert_Class_2_VA.pem
-share/purple/ca-certs/VeriSign_Class3_Extended_Validation_CA.pem
-share/purple/ca-certs/VeriSign_Class_3_Primary_CA-G2.pem
-share/purple/ca-certs/VeriSign_Class_3_Primary_CA-G5-2.pem
-share/purple/ca-certs/VeriSign_Class_3_Primary_CA-G5.pem
-share/purple/ca-certs/VeriSign_International_Server_Class_3_CA.pem
-share/purple/ca-certs/Verisign_Class3_Primary_CA.pem
+share/purple/ca-certs/mozilla.pem
share/sounds/purple/alert.wav
share/sounds/purple/login.wav
share/sounds/purple/logout.wav
diff --git a/chat/libpurple/buildlink3.mk b/chat/libpurple/buildlink3.mk
index bc270b81dc2..692ba604655 100644
--- a/chat/libpurple/buildlink3.mk
+++ b/chat/libpurple/buildlink3.mk
@@ -1,12 +1,12 @@
-# $NetBSD: buildlink3.mk,v 1.42 2016/01/17 18:48:15 wiz Exp $
+# $NetBSD: buildlink3.mk,v 1.43 2017/03/11 03:02:39 khorben Exp $
BUILDLINK_TREE+= libpurple
.if !defined(LIBPURPLE_BUILDLINK3_MK)
LIBPURPLE_BUILDLINK3_MK:=
-BUILDLINK_API_DEPENDS.libpurple+= libpurple>=2.7.9
-BUILDLINK_ABI_DEPENDS.libpurple+= libpurple>=2.10.12
+BUILDLINK_API_DEPENDS.libpurple+= libpurple>=2.11.0
+BUILDLINK_ABI_DEPENDS.libpurple+= libpurple>=2.11.0
BUILDLINK_PKGSRCDIR.libpurple?= ../../chat/libpurple
pkgbase := libpurple
diff --git a/chat/libpurple/distinfo b/chat/libpurple/distinfo
index c4afdf9d421..dcf31422d07 100644
--- a/chat/libpurple/distinfo
+++ b/chat/libpurple/distinfo
@@ -1,9 +1,9 @@
-$NetBSD: distinfo,v 1.46 2016/07/06 09:55:39 wiz Exp $
+$NetBSD: distinfo,v 1.47 2017/03/11 03:02:39 khorben Exp $
-SHA1 (pidgin-2.10.12.tar.bz2) = 4550a447f35b869554c2d7d7bc1c7d84a01ce238
-RMD160 (pidgin-2.10.12.tar.bz2) = 22b14ba35cef488cb25d89b59aeb6c9923a4d924
-SHA512 (pidgin-2.10.12.tar.bz2) = 4756bed3ae78b48bfeaa586def3c7a0014db76ce14ae8c6773c96bdca24b65e92b2805270af43960e2a11a600aeac35e030faa3f79dbe3301084ca9d970a5f03
-Size (pidgin-2.10.12.tar.bz2) = 9837598 bytes
+SHA1 (pidgin-2.11.0.tar.bz2) = 9738a424ac9f6da8b68ebf11af00c55cafd6b4d2
+RMD160 (pidgin-2.11.0.tar.bz2) = 14edb897935f94eb57c09e3a6e5dbe41136941c5
+SHA512 (pidgin-2.11.0.tar.bz2) = d6a9bb8075b475e5204d730075b432ca0f1cb91b6337f98e506587132581e6928a826b47e0b94fb9eaedc79c5be0a8237c4671fc26dba97dedad1adb74c9abfa
+Size (pidgin-2.11.0.tar.bz2) = 10037480 bytes
SHA1 (patch-configure) = 74d033d148d74d0233c7ad33411b9ebcfbab7851
SHA1 (patch-libpurple_plugins_perl_common_Makefile.PL.in) = 40326826000ed42e7570486f89f3196b58093d48
SHA1 (patch-libpurple_protocols_jabber_auth__scram.c) = e86c5099176231402bb1b05ae391175634caa617
diff --git a/chat/pidgin/PLIST b/chat/pidgin/PLIST
index aa3aa9ff065..18509eb1332 100644
--- a/chat/pidgin/PLIST
+++ b/chat/pidgin/PLIST
@@ -1,4 +1,4 @@
-@comment $NetBSD: PLIST,v 1.22 2014/12/07 08:45:59 obache Exp $
+@comment $NetBSD: PLIST,v 1.23 2017/03/11 03:02:39 khorben Exp $
bin/pidgin
include/pidgin/gtkaccount.h
include/pidgin/gtkblist-theme-loader.h
@@ -166,6 +166,7 @@ share/pixmaps/pidgin/emblems/16/game.png
share/pixmaps/pidgin/emblems/16/half-operator.png
share/pixmaps/pidgin/emblems/16/hiptop.png
share/pixmaps/pidgin/emblems/16/male.png
+share/pixmaps/pidgin/emblems/16/mobile.png
share/pixmaps/pidgin/emblems/16/not-authorized.png
share/pixmaps/pidgin/emblems/16/operator.png
share/pixmaps/pidgin/emblems/16/secure.png